MUSIC

PACIFIC AMPHITHEATRE CONCERTS

The Orange County Fair is presenting its summer concert series at

the Pacific Amphitheatre: today, Devo and Cake; Wednesday, Steely

Dan; Thursday, the Doobie Brothers and Buddy Guy; Friday, the Doors:

21st Century; Saturday, Alanis Morissette and Jason Mraz; Sunday, Bob

Dylan; July 29, Alan Jackson and Joe Nichols; July 30, Kenny Loggins

and Michael McDonald; July 31, 3 Doors Down and Our Lady Peace; Aug.

1, Jethro Tull; Aug. 2, Roxy Music and David Lindley and El Rayo-X;

and Aug. 3, Boston. For concert information, call (714) 708-1870 or

visit www.ocfair.com. To order tickets, call (714) 740-2000.

O.C. FAIR CONCERTS AT THE ARENA

The Orange County Fair is presenting many summer events and

concerts at its Citizens Business Bank Arena: today, Billy Bob

Thorton; Wednesday, Rick Springfield; Thursday, Phil Vassar; Friday,

the Fabulous Thunderbirds; Saturday, Royal Crown Revue; Sunday, the

Latin Music Festival; July 29, the Mountain Top with Dr. Ralph

Stanley, featuring Rhonda Vincent and special guest Clark; July 30,

the Fab Four; July 31, Ziggy Marley; Aug. 1, Ozomatli; Aug. 2, Bull

riding, with a musical performance by BR5-49; and Aug. 3, the Fiesta

Del Charro. The Orange County Fair is on Fair Drive in Costa Mesa.

Information: (714) 708-FAIR.

BOLERO AND RHAPSODY

Maestro Carl St. Clair and the Pacific Symphony, with guest

pianist Valentina Lisitsa, will explore the vibrant rhythms of Spain

in a concert called “Bolero and Rhapsody” at 8 p.m. today at the

Verizon Wireless Amphitheater. Tickets cost $19 to $85. To order,

call (714) 755-5799.
